The sekt Brut Reserve from the winery Weingut Harkamp has been rated in 2023 by Peter Moser with 94 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ape varieties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, Weißburgunder from the region Styria in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Medium golden yellow in colour with silver reflections and a very fine, intense mousse. On the nose, a multi-layered bouquet with hints of biscuit, yellow peach, fresh apple, tangerine zest, and some blossom honey. The palate is juicy and elegant, with a touch of sweet fruit and pastry notes, fresh and mineral, with a lingering finish. A versatile wine, this has long been a classic in the Sekt Austria Brut category. (Deg. 5/22).
